The Benefits Of Procurement Outsourcing: Saving Time And Money

procurement outsourcing, also known as the practice of transferring certain procurement activities and responsibilities to a third-party service provider, has gained popularity in recent years among businesses looking to streamline their operations and cut costs. By outsourcing procurement functions, companies can leverage the expertise and resources of specialized procurement professionals to manage their sourcing, purchasing, and supplier relationships more efficiently. This article will discuss the benefits of procurement outsourcing and how it can help organizations save time and money.

One of the primary advantages of procurement outsourcing is cost savings. By outsourcing procurement activities to a third-party provider, companies can reduce their operating costs by eliminating the need to hire and train in-house procurement staff. Outsourcing allows companies to access specialized procurement expertise on an as-needed basis, which can result in lower overall procurement costs. Additionally, outsourcing providers often have established relationships with suppliers and can negotiate better prices and terms on behalf of their clients, further driving cost savings.

In addition to cost savings, procurement outsourcing can help organizations save time by streamlining the procurement process. By outsourcing sourcing, purchasing, and supplier management activities to a third-party provider, companies can free up their internal resources to focus on core business activities. This can lead to faster procurement cycles, reduced lead times, and improved efficiency in the procurement process. With an outsourced procurement provider handling the day-to-day procurement tasks, companies can devote more time and attention to strategic activities that drive growth and innovation.

Another benefit of procurement outsourcing is increased access to expertise and resources. Outsourcing providers typically have a team of experienced procurement professionals with specialized skills and knowledge in sourcing, negotiating, and supplier management. By partnering with an outsourcing provider, companies can tap into this expertise and benefit from best practices and industry insights that can help improve their procurement process. Additionally, outsourcing providers often have access to advanced procurement technologies and tools that can enhance efficiency and effectiveness in procurement operations.

procurement outsourcing can also help companies achieve greater scalability and flexibility in their procurement operations. By partnering with an outsourcing provider, companies can easily scale their procurement resources up or down based on changing business needs and market conditions. This flexibility allows companies to adapt quickly to fluctuations in demand, market trends, and operational requirements without incurring high fixed costs. Additionally, outsourcing providers can offer performance-based pricing models that align with the specific needs and goals of their clients, providing greater flexibility and cost control.
